Obverse description The obverse depicts a detailed relief view of the Pössneck town hall (Rathaus), a multi-storey Late Gothic building with two prominent spires and ornate dormer windows. The legend arcs around the upper field reading 'RATHAUS PÖSSNECK' and along the lower field 'ERBAUT 1478-1533', separated by a border of raised dots.
Obverse script Log in to see details
Obverse lettering RATHAUS PÖSSNECK ERBAUT 1478-1533
Reverse description The reverse features the coat of arms of the city of Pössneck in high relief, depicting a rampant lion on a vertically lined heraldic shield surmounted by a mural crown with a row of raised dots. The circular legend reads 'WAPPEN DER STADT PÖSSNECK' around the lower periphery of the field.
